Mattern Capital Management LLC Sells 47,542 Shares of Realty Income Corporation $O

Mattern Capital Management LLC lowered its position in shares of Realty Income Corporation (NYSE:OFree Report) by 34.1% in the 1st qu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The fund owned 91,836 shares of the real estate investment trust’s stock after selling 47,542 shares during the period. Mattern Capital Management LLC’s holdings in Realty Income were worth $5,619,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Realty Income Profile

(Free Report)

Realty Income Corporation (NYSE: O) is a real estate investment trust (REIT) that acquires, owns and manages commercial properties subject primarily to long-term net lease agreements. The company’s business model focuses on generating predictable, contractual rental income by leasing properties to tenants under agreements that typically place responsibility for taxes, insurance and maintenance on the tenant. Realty Income is publicly traded on the New York Stock Exchange and markets itself as a reliable income-oriented REIT.

Realty Income’s portfolio is concentrated in single-tenant, retail and service-oriented properties such as drugstores, convenience stores, dollar and discount retailers, restaurants, and other essential-service businesses.
